What changed between DOL Form 5500 filings

plan year 2022 → plan year 2023

  • Intermountain Retail Store Employees Pension Plan reported net income rose from $4M in the plan year 2022 filing to $19M in the plan year 2023 filing.
  • Intermountain Retail Store Employees Pension Plan end-of-year assets rose from $187M in the plan year 2022 filing to $207M in the plan year 2023 filing.
  • Intermountain Retail Store Employees Pension Plan reported participants fell from 3,823 in the plan year 2022 filing to 3,762 in the plan year 2023 filing.

Frequently Asked Questions

How did Intermountain Retail Store Employees Pension Plan assets move in 2023?
Intermountain Retail Store Employees Pension Plan grew at a solid clip - up 10.2% during 2023, from $187M to $207M. Reported net income was $19M.
How have Intermountain Retail Store Employees Pension Plan Board of Trustees plan assets changed over time?
Across 3 plan years on file (2022-2024), Intermountain Retail Store Employees Pension Plan Board of Trustees's sponsor-wide assets grew 19.2%, from $187M to $223M.
Where does Intermountain Retail Store Employees Pension Plan rank by assets among Form 5500 filers?
Intermountain Retail Store Employees Pension Plan ranks in the 95th percentile by end-of-year assets among 127,072 plans that reported assets for plan year 2023 (in the top 5% of all filed plans by assets).
